Wequetequock Cove is a cove located in southeastern Connecticut, near Stonington. It empties into . Elihu Island and Goat Island (Connecticut) are in Wequetequock Cove. is located along its shore.[1] Fishers Island, New York is a boundary between the Cove and the Atlantic Ocean.
